3 Things to Consider When Choosing a Drug Rehab in Marietta, MN

Is The Treatment Center Accredited?

A good way to determine if a drug rehab in Marietta is ideal would be by checking if it is accredited. In particular, you should find out if the program has JCBH - Joint Commission Behavioral Health Accreditation.

Other accreditations that you need to check - and which would point out that the program offers excellent treatment staff and facilities - include but are not limited to:

  • Commission on Accreditation and Rehabilitation Facilities
  • Council on Accreditation
  • Healthcare Facilities Accreditation Program
  • National Committee for Quality Assurance
  • The Joint Commission
  • What Kind of Setting Is the Rehab In?

    There are many things that you should think about while looking for a drug rehab program in Marietta. For instance, you need to find out as much as you can about the setting in which the rehab is located.

    If it is close to a high-risk neighborhood, your probability of relapsing would be higher - especially if you choose outpatient treatment. The important thing is to ensure that you choose a rehab center that is located in a setting that can motivate you to continue with your recovery journey over the long term.

    What Is the Cost of Rehab?

    The cost of addiction treatment and rehabilitation services in Marietta can be expensive. Luckily, you will find that most programs will accept insurance, and this can help you offset the cost in the long run.

    If you already have a health insurance plan, you should discuss it with the drug rehab center to see if they will accept it. You may also want to get in touch with your insurance provider to find out how much of your treatment they will cover.

    There are also other facilities that will rely on government funding and donations. These might be ideal if you do not have any insurance coverage. The important thing is to do your research so that you learn about all the options that are open to you.
